The US hantavirus case was false positive; outbreak cases drop from 11 to 10

Health authorities report a false-positive hantavirus case, informing risk assessment and public health responses.

While not strictly AI-focused, the piece touches on how AI-assisted data analysis informs epidemiology and outbreak tracking. The correction of a false positive demonstrates the importance of rigorous data validation, statistical methods, and cross-institution collaboration in managing public health risks. As AI tools become more embedded in health surveillance, the ability to detect and correct errors quickly becomes a defining feature of responsible AI-enabled health systems.

Takeaways: Data quality, model validation, and transparent communication will be key as AI augments public health decision-making. Stakeholders should demand robust audit trails and explainability to maintain trust in AI-assisted health insights.

Outlook: Public health AI will continue to evolve, with emphasis on reliability, privacy, and accountability for AI-driven health surveillance tools.
